German Potato Salad
Ingredients:
8-10 medium-sized red potatoes
4 slices of bacon
1 T flour
2 T white sugar
1/3 c. water
1/4 c. white wine vinegar
1/2 c. chopped green onions
salt & pepper to taste
Directions:
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add potatoes; cook until tender but still firm, about 15 minutes. Drain, cool and chop.
Place bacon in a large, deep skillet. Cook over medium high heat until evenly brown. Drain, reserving bacon fat.
Add the flour, sugar, water and vinegar to skillet and cook in reserved bacon fat over medium heat until dressing is thick.
Crumble bacon, add it to skillet. Add potatoes and green onions to skillet and stir until coated. Season with salt & pepper. Serve warm.
